     Passover may have "passed over", but I wanted an opportunity to share another musical feature of the holiday. During Pesach it is customary to recite the beautiful love poetry of Shir Hashirim- The Song of Songs attributed to King Solomon. The poetry is romantic and sensual, but as a religious text it is seen as an allegory of the relationship between God and the people of Israel. 

     You are probably familiar with some of the well known passages: "I am my beloved's and my beloved is mine", "Let him kiss me with the kisses of his mouth! For your love is better than wine", and one of my father's favorites: "Many waters cannot quench love, neither can floods drown it.". 

      There are many Israeli songs that have been composed using these beautiful words. Here are a few of the better known songs:
